Homemade Strawberry Ice Cream

260 min 8 servings Medium

Instructions

1

Prepare the strawberry puree

In a blender, combine the strawberries, 1/2 cup sugar, and lemon juice. Blend until smooth. Optionally, strain through a fine-mesh sieve to remove seeds.

Pro tip: Use the freshest strawberries you can find for optimal flavour.

2

Mix the ice cream base

In a medium bowl, whisk together the milk, heavy cream, remaining 1/2 cup sugar, and vanilla extract until the sugar is dissolved.

3

Combine puree with ice cream base

Stir the strawberry puree into the ice cream base until well combined.

4

Chill the mixture

Cover the mixture and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or until thoroughly chilled.

Pro tip: Ensure the mixture is very cold before churning for the best results.

5

Churn the ice cream

Pour the chilled m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er's instructions, usually about 20-25 minutes.

Pro tip: The ice cream should have a soft-serve consistency when done churning.

6

Freeze the ice cream

Transfer the churned ice cream to an airtight container and freeze for at least 2 hours or until firm.

Pro tip: For a softer texture, remove the ice cream from the freezer 10 minutes before serving.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use ripe strawberries for the best flavour.
  • Chill the mixture thoroughly before churning.
  • For a smoother texture, strain the puree to remove seeds.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the primary flavour of this ice cream?

The primary flavour of this ice cream is strawberry, enhanced by fresh lemon juice and vanilla.

How long does it take to make homemade strawberry ice cream?

The total time to make homemade strawberry ice cream is about 4 hours and 20 minutes, including chilling and freezing time.

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?

Yes, you can use frozen strawberries. Thaw them completely and drain excess liquid before using.

How many calories are in a serving of this strawberry ice cream?

Each serving of this strawberry ice cream contains approximately 210 calories.

What are some serving suggestions for strawberry ice cream?

Serve strawberry ice cream with fresh strawberries, whipped cream, or in a cone for a delightful treat.

How should I store leftover strawberry ice cream?

Store leftover strawberry ice cream in an airtight container in the freezer for up to two weeks.
